Summary

Melanie Stryder refuses to fade away. Earth has been invaded by a species that takes over the minds of their human hosts while leaving their bodies intact, and most of humanity has succumbed. Wanderer, the invading "soul" who has been given Melanie's body, knew about the challenges of living inside a human: the overwhelming emotions, the too-vivid memories.

But there was one difficulty Wanderer didn't expect: the former tenant of her body refusing to relinquish possession of her mind. Melanie fills Wanderer's thoughts with visions of the man Melanie loves - Jared, a human who still lives in hiding. Unable to separate herself from her body's desires, Wanderer yearns for a man she's never met. As outside forces make Wanderer and Melanie unwilling allies, they set off to search for the man they both love.

Very introspective, not concluded

Would you try another book written by Stephenie Meyer or narrated by Kate Reading?

I enjoy Kate Reading's narration of audio books, they are always full of character and well rehearsed. You can tell which characters are speaking just by listening to her voice - it's an amazing skill.
The story was another thing. Although a good science fiction story is believable and compelling, I found that this story was more about human emotions than good fiction. There's the usual struggle of good versus evil but simply within the same person and not on a global scale. Even the science element of this fiction is a bit too simplistic to be believable.
None the less, I persevered and found the story entertaining although you could guess the ending!
I will likely give Ms Meyer's future sci-fi stories a miss but will keep an open mind - especially since her twilight series was so compelling!

The Host by Stephenie Meyer

I decided to listen to this book before going to the cinema to see the film. It's my kind of story e.g. aliens, sci-fi etc. I did like it I have to admit but...... It's a typical Stephenie Meyer story, there is just too much soppy love in it for me, and like the Twilight saga the main character (admittedly she is a Host and therefore two people), is in love with two men.

Its a good story, but if there is an abridged version, sci-fi fans may prefer that.

Twilight fans who read the books and like sci-fi will love it.
